The Importance of Personal Lenses in Writing
Personal lenses significantly enhance storytelling by bringing unique perspectives to the narrative. Writers are encouraged to leverage their individual experiences, whether derived from hobbies, professions, or life events, to create stories that resonate deeply with audiences. This personal touch is essential because it allows the writer's authentic voice to shine through, making the work feel genuine and relatable. By utilizing personal experiences, writers can transform ordinary scenes into compelling narratives that better engage readers on an emotional level.
